Contains the following, according to the entry in the catalog:
vol. 1. 1876, Boston tax lists, etc., 1674-1695 -- v. 2. 1877, Boston town records, 1634-1661, the book of possessions of Suffolk County, Mass. -- v. 3. 1878, Charlestown land records, 1638-1802 -- v. 4. 1880, Dorchester town records, 1632-1687 -- v. 5. 1880, N.I. Bowditch's "Gleaner' articles on Boston history -- v. 6. 1880, Roxbury land and church records -- v. 7. 1881, Boston records, 1660- 1701 -- v. 8. 1882, Boston records, 1700-1728 -- v. 9. 1883, Boston births, baptisms, marriages and deaths, 1630-1699 -- v. 10. 1886, miscellaneous papers. The Boston directory, 1789. The Boston directory, 1796 -- v. 11. 1884, records of Boston selectmen, 1701- 1715 -- v. 12. 1885, Boston records, 1729-1742 -- v. 13. 1885, Records of Boston selectmen, 1716-1736 -- v. 14. 1885, Boston town records, 1742-1757 -- v. 15. 1886, records of Boston selectmen, 1736-1742 -- v. 16. 1886, Boston town records, 1758-1769 -- v. 17. 1887. Selectmen's minutes, 1742/3-1753 -- v. 18. 1887, Boston town records, 1770-1777 -- v. 19. 1887, Selectmen's minutes, 1754-1763 -- v. 20. 1889, Selectmen's minutes, 1764-1768 -- v. 21. 1898, Dorchester births, marriages, and deaths to the end of 1825 -- v. 22. 1890, the statistics of the United States direct tax of 1798, as assessed on Boston. The name of the inhabitants of Boston in 1790, as collected for the first national census -- v. 23. 1893, Selectmen's minutes, 1769-1775 -- v. 24. 1894, Boston births, 1700- 1800 -- v. 25. 1894, Selectmen's minutes, 1776-1786 -- v. 26. 1895, Boston town records, 1778-1783 -- v. 27. 1896, Selectmen's minutes, 1787-1798 -- v. 28. 1898, Boston marriages, 1700-1751 -- v. 29. 1900, miscellaneous papers -- v. 30. 1902. Boston marriages, 1751-1809 -- v. 31. 1903, Boston town records, 1784-1796 -- v. 32. 1903, Aspinwall notarial records, 1644-1651 -- v. 33. 1904, Selectmen's minutes, 1700-1810 -- v. 34. 1905, Drake, F.S. The town of Roxbury -- v. 35. 1905, Boston town records, 1796-1813 -- v. 36. 1905, Dorchester Vital records, 1826-1849 -- v. 37. 1906, Boston town records, 1814-1822 -- v. 38. 1908, Selectmen's minutes, 1811-1818 -- v. 39. 1909, Selectmen's minutes, 1818-1822.
